If you have commercial garbage and recycling bins and commingle your recycling, then you have probably encountered a few messes brought on by “dumpster divers”. Their activities often result in an unsightly mess. There are ways to keep dumpster divers from turning your dumpsters inside out: Get an Extra Dumpster and Separate Glass and Aluminum Out Since these individuals are frequently after glass bottles and/or aluminum cans, get an extra bin for just glass and aluminum recyclables.…
